On Mon, Jun 10, 2024 at 04:58:52PM +0200, Jan Beulich wrote:
> mfn_valid() is RAM-focused; it will often return false for MMIO. Yet
> access to actual MMIO space should not generally be restricted to UC
> only; especially video frame buffer accesses are unduly affected by such
> a restriction. Permit PAT use for directly assigned MMIO as long as the
> domain is known to have been granted some level of cache control.
>
> Signed-off-by: Jan Beulich <jbeulich@xxxxxxxx>
> ---
> Considering that we've just declared PVH Dom0 "supported", this may well
> qualify for 4.19. The issue was specifically very noticable there.
>
> The conditional may be more complex than really necessary, but it's in
> line with what we do elsewhere. And imo better continue to be a little
> too restrictive, than moving to too lax.

Looking at this, shouldn't the !mfn_valid special case be removed, and
mfns without a valid page be processed normally, so that the guest
MTRR values are taken into account, and no iPAT is enforced?
I also think this likely wants a:
Fixes: 81fd0d3ca4b2 ('x86/hvm: simplify 'mmio_direct' check in
epte_get_entry_emt()')
As AFAICT before that commit direct MMIO regions would set iPAT to WB,
which would result in the correct attributes (albeit guest MTRR was
still ignored).
